hola foreros espero esten bien.
Les cuento mi inquietud... resulta que tengo un pagina principal en php en la cual agrego y cargo los comentarios a traves de jquery con .load haciendo uso de otra pagina php para agregar el comentario y otra para cagarlos.
Resulta que en la pagina encargada de cargar o hacer la consulta de los comentarios he utilizado el plugin jeditable para asi mismo editarlos. este archivo php es llamado mostrar_comentario.php y cabe recordar que se carga en el archivo php principal llamado actas.php a traves de jqery con el metodo .load.
no se porque razon cuando hago las pruebas dede actas.php no me funciona el jeditable pero haciendo las pruebas directamente al archivo mostrar_comentarios me funciona perfecto.. revise que esten incluidas bien las librerias y todo y jumm ni idea.. asi que pues les pido su colaboracion para esto. aqui lesdejo el codigo y muchas gracias.
mostrar_comentario.php
Código PHP:
<? session_start();?>
<?php
require_once("../elvago9.php");
?>
<?php
$elvago9 = new comentarios("localhost", "master", "Curaduri@Sistem@s", "curaduria", $_SESSION['usuario'][0]['nombre']);
$elvago9->sql_connect();
$result_set = mysql_query("SELECT * FROM coments where radicado like '$_SESSION[radicado]' ORDER BY id DESC");
$number = mysql_num_rows($result_set);
if ($number) {
while ($row = mysql_fetch_array($result_set))
{
$id[] = $row['id'];
$usuario[] = $row['usuario'];
$faltante[] = $row['faltante'];
$comentario[] = $row['comentario'];
// $fecha[] = $row['fecha'];
}
$max_show = 10;
if (isset($_GET["page"]))
$page = $_GET["page"];
else
$page = 1;
$from2 = $page * $max_show;
if ($from2 > $number)
{
$diff = $number % $max_show;
$from2 = $number;
$from1 = $from2 - $diff;
}
else
$from1 = $from2 - $max_show;?>
<html>
<head>
<script type="text/javascript" src="Includes/jquery.js"></script>
<script type="text/javascript" src="Includes/jeditable/jquery.jeditable.js"></script>
<script type="text/javascript" src="Includes/jeditable/js.js"></script>
</head>
<body>
<?
for ($i=$from1; $i < $from2; $i++) {
?>
<table id="table">
<thead>
<tr class="head">
<th style="width:340px;float:left;background:#9DE1F4; border:1px solid #15A4A4">observaciones de</th>
<th style="width:340px;float:left;background:#9DE1F4; border:1px solid #15A4A4">faltantes de</th>
</tr>
</thead>
<tbody>
<tr>
<td style="width:320px;float:left;padding:10px;"><div style="width:320px;float:left;padding:10px;" class="textarea" id="<? echo "comentario-".$id[$i]; ?>"><? echo utf8_encode($comentario[$i]); ?></div></td>
<td style="width:320px;float:left;padding:10px;"><div style="width:320px;float:left;padding:10px;" class="textarea" id="<? echo "faltante-".$id[$i]; ?>"><? echo utf8_encode($faltante[$i]); ?></div></td>
</tr>
<?php
}
?>
</tbody>
</table>
</body>
</html>
<?
}
if ($from1 > 0)
{
$previous = $page - 1;
echo "<a href=\"javascript:ActualizarComentarios(".$previous.")\"><< Página anterior</a> ";
}
if ($from2 < $number)
{
$next = $page + 1;
echo " <a href=\"javascript:ActualizarComentarios(".$next.")\">Página siguiente >></a>";
} else {
echo "<div style='color: #9F6000; background-color: #FEEFB3; border: 1px solid;' align='center'>No hay comentarios</div>";
}
$elvago9->sql_close();
?>